diff options
author | makamys <makamys@outlook.com> | 2021-05-23 10:10:26 +0200 |
---|---|---|
committer | makamys <makamys@outlook.com> | 2021-05-23 10:10:26 +0200 |
commit | 0b85478110c9cba9a6d200d176ffc3cf09a61b30 (patch) | |
tree | 2e5c2fa0500d5b325c2bfeb1aebc196765183031 /src/main/java/makamys/lodmod/renderer | |
parent | 79cd910660eb3caa9e181772372e920a3b92c7ee (diff) | |
download | Neodymium-0b85478110c9cba9a6d200d176ffc3cf09a61b30.tar.gz Neodymium-0b85478110c9cba9a6d200d176ffc3cf09a61b30.tar.bz2 Neodymium-0b85478110c9cba9a6d200d176ffc3cf09a61b30.zip |
Ignore BOP logs and GT6 tile entities in, make blacklist configurable
Diffstat (limited to 'src/main/java/makamys/lodmod/renderer')
-rw-r--r-- | src/main/java/makamys/lodmod/renderer/SimpleChunkMesh.java |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/src/main/java/makamys/lodmod/renderer/SimpleChunkMesh.java b/src/main/java/makamys/lodmod/renderer/SimpleChunkMesh.java index 77b9a93..04c16a4 100644 --- a/src/main/java/makamys/lodmod/renderer/SimpleChunkMesh.java +++ b/src/main/java/makamys/lodmod/renderer/SimpleChunkMesh.java @@ -20,7 +20,6 @@ import makamys.lodmod.LODMod; import net.minecraft.block.Block; import net.minecraft.block.BlockGrass; import net.minecraft.block.BlockLeaves; -import net.minecraft.block.BlockLog; import net.minecraft.block.material.Material; import net.minecraft.client.Minecraft; import net.minecraft.client.renderer.texture.TextureAtlasSprite; @@ -45,7 +44,12 @@ public class SimpleChunkMesh extends Mesh { } private static boolean isBad(Block block) { - return block instanceof BlockLog; + for(Class clazz : LODMod.blockClassBlacklist) { + if(clazz.isInstance(block)) { + return true; + } + } + return false; } public static List<SimpleChunkMesh> generateSimpleMeshes(Chunk target){ |